The Gilera Nexus 125 is a four-stroke, single cylinder motorcycle with a fuel capacity of 15 liters. It has a liquid-cooled engine with a capacity of 124cc, delivering an output of 14.5hp at 9750 rpm and 11.7Nm of torque at 8000rpm. The bike’s frame consists of double cradle trellis made of high-strength steel tubes, front telescopic hydraulic fork, and rear double hydraulic shock absorber. Front and rear brakes are single discs and it has a twist-and-go CVT transmission. The Nexus 125 has a wheelbase of 1,530mm and a seat height of 810mm, with a dry weight of 174.0 kg and a wet weight of 186.0 kg. Its front and rear tires are sized 120/70-14 and 140/60-14, respectively. The Gilera Nexus 125 was manufactured between 2006 and 2008.
